Not asking for staking, I may never do so depenending on the responses to a few questions.

What type of volume and level of buyins for either cash tables (6 handed NLH) or SnG (6 handed) would it be deemed acceptable or attractive for someone to back/mentor another player?

I currently only ever player $1 to $6 Sng's and my cash tables experiance has only ever gone up to 0.10c / .025c tables. Would it need to be much higher or would this be fine if I was putting the volume in.

I am considering one of those bankroll sites but my worry is the volume you need to put in might not be possible for me.

I am a winning player but tend to go on huge tilt if bad beat comes to me, so believe the discipline of someone elses money would prevent this from happening. I did the blonde staking a while ago and think my roi was quiet decent but obv I was only playing $5 SNG's so no one made huge profits!

What sort of sample size do you have at given limits? And what sort of winrate? I think you need to be able to show at least 50,000 hands at a stake to claim to be beating it personally for nlhe.

r.e the tilt thing lots of people say they think that playing other peoples money would stop them tilting but in my experience this really really isnt the case, the thing about tilt is it is just loss of emotional and mental control, and when that happens whose money your playing does loose relevance as much as you think it wouldn't and with all the best will. I have had some EPIC tilted blowups in the past really the only way to aviod it is to

be in a good mood when you play, not tired/hungry/distracted
be playing within a bankroll - if you're playin g a $5k roll getting a horrid suckout for a buyin at 50nl isnt anywhere near as tilting as when playing off a $400 roll
really learn to seperate yourself from results and be able to analsye each play by it's merit win or loose - its obv annoying to play a hand well and get ul, but its just as bad to play a hand badly and win (altho not in the short term lol Smiley )

r.e. volume 20hours a week playing ~80 hands per table per hour 4 tabling = 25,600 hands per month which would be above fine for any of the bankroll backing sites afaik

Not sure if im allowed to say this (take this out of im breaking rules or w/e cos im involved it) but the firm might be a really good place to start as you could get free mentoring with that level of volume and there are one or two EXTREMELY good nl cash game players on the site.

Not wanting to flame/de-rail, just think you will prolly need a bigger proven sample to get backing from one of the sites
